Abstract

A method and structure for providing improved tactile response in fiber reinforced polymer composite materials is disclosed. The effect is achieved by jacketing the reinforcing carbon fiber with a thin coating of non-carbide forming metal, such as nickel. The resulting chemical and mechanical discontinuity at the fiber/coating interface allows for more transient energy to be retained within the fiber, while the strong chemical bond of the polymer matrix to the metal coating assures mechanical integrity of the composite. The result is a composite which retains its characteristic weight, stiffness, and strength, but exhibits increased low frequency vibrational sensitivity in composite applications, such as for fishing rods and other recreational equipment.
